Misconception: All Accuseds Are Guilty
Often, individuals wrongly believe that if a person is charged with a criminal activity, they must be guilty. You may presume that the lawful system is infallible, but that's much from the fact. Fees can stem from misconceptions, mistaken identifications, or insufficient evidence. It's critical to bear in mind that in the eyes of the legislation, you're innocent up until proven guilty.
This anticipation of virtue is the bedrock of the criminal justice system. Misconception: Silence Equals Admission
Many think that if you select to continue to be quiet when accused of a criminal activity, you're essentially admitting guilt. Nonetheless, this couldn't be additionally from the truth. Your right to stay silent is safeguarded under the Fifth Amendment to avoid self-incrimination. It's a legal guard, not a sign of regret.
When you're silent, you're actually exercising a fundamental right. This stops you from saying something that might accidentally hurt your defense. Remember, in the heat of the minute, it's simple to get baffled or talk erroneously. Police can interpret your words in means you didn't intend.
By staying quiet, you offer your attorney the best opportunity to protect you effectively, without the issue of misunderstood declarations.

Misconception: Public Defenders Are Ineffective
The misunderstanding that public defenders are inadequate persists, yet it's essential to recognize their essential role in the justice system. Many believe that because public defenders are frequently strained with cases, they can not give top quality protection. However, this overlooks the deepness of their dedication and expertise.
Public defenders are totally certified attorneys that've chosen to specialize in criminal legislation. They're as certified as personal legal representatives and commonly more experienced in trial job due to the volume of situations they take care of. You could believe they're much less inspired since they do not select their clients, however in truth, they're deeply committed to the ideals of justice and equal rights.
It is very important to keep in mind that all legal representatives, whether public or personal, face difficulties and constraints. Public protectors usually work with fewer sources and under more pressure. Yet, they constantly show resilience and imagination in their protection strategies.
Their role isn't simply a job; it's an objective to make certain that everyone, no matter revenue, gets a reasonable test.
